(In reply to Allon Mureinik from comment #1) > Daniel/Sean, AFAIK, this was intentional (perhaps for fleecing needs)? > Any insight? Yes, the behavior is by design. For DirectLUN disks, we don't gray out LUNs used by storage domains; instead, a warning is displayed in the dialog when selecting such LUNs.
